Perceptions

When all you have is a hammer, every problem looks like a nail!

In this bizarre world, chaos rules the roost. We hardly, if ever see the whole picture. Every day we are bombarded with clichés and stereotypes and our mind is conditioned accordingly. Ever seen a villain without his personal brand of maniacal laughter? Or seen a bomb which was not stopped with only a second left till detonation??

Sometimes we try to fit the problem in our prejudiced views— like trying to drive a square peg in a circular hole. We see the carrot held up in front of our eyes, not the fact that this essentially implies we are the donkey.

Human beings, by nature, are inclined to trust the bad news rather than good news . For example if a person tells you that you have won a lottery of a petty sum- say Rs.100 you ask “what’s the catch?” or maybe “do you think I’m a fool?” But if the same person tells you that your house was on fire, you will probably go running there as though…well… your house was on fire!

But still, there is hope, hope for a better day; after all we do get up on Monday mornings, don’t we?
